Carol K. K. Chan is a scholar working on Developmental and Educational Psychology, Education and Computer Science Applications. According to data from OpenAlex, Carol K. K. Chan has authored 28 papers receiving a total of 1.0k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 24 papers in Developmental and Educational Psychology, 19 papers in Education and 5 papers in Computer Science Applications. Recurrent topics in Carol K. K. Chan’s work include Innovative Teaching and Learning Methods (20 papers), Educational Strategies and Epistemologies (13 papers) and Online and Blended Learning (8 papers). Carol K. K. Chan is often cited by papers focused on Innovative Teaching and Learning Methods (20 papers), Educational Strategies and Epistemologies (13 papers) and Online and Blended Learning (8 papers). Carol K. K. Chan collaborates with scholars based in Hong Kong, China and Canada. Carol K. K. Chan's co-authors include Carl Bereiter, Jan van Aalst, Linda S. Siegel, Yuen-Yan Chan, Susanna Siu‐sze Yeung, Feng Lin, Colin Jamora, Shih‐Wei Chen, Marlene Scardamalia and Pedro Lee and has published in prestigious journals such as Nature, Cognitive Psychology and Computers & Education.
